
The discovery of gold in Zeballos in the 1920’s resulted in a massive influx of miners and adventurers. The historic buildings in the village are a living reminder of those frontier days.
Tour the waters aboard your own vessel or arrange for an excursion with a local charter guide. Comfortable accommodation and several cafes welcome visitors.
The village is fast becoming a favourite destination for kayakers, sportsfishers and nature lovers who want to leave the crowds behind and experience the wild west coast of Vancouver Island.
The road to Zeballos turns west off Highway 19 just north of Woss. The 40 km gravel service road is well-maintained and continues beyond Zeballos to Fair Harbour. Along the way watch for bears, deer and elk crossing the road and eagles soaring overhead.
